Ingredients:  
Ingredients:  
1 1/2 cups self-rising flour
1 cup whipping cream (heavy cream)

Directions:
Directions:
Mix flour and heavy cream in bowl until a smooth dough forms. Do NOT over mix. Roll dough 1/2-in. thick on lightly floured surface. Cut with a small cutter or 2-in. cookie cutter for larger biscuits. Arrange the rounds 1-in. apart on baking sheet. Bake in 425º oven for 10 min. or just until golden brown.

Personal Notes:
Personal Notes:
NOTE: Biscuits may be frozen on baking sheet for future use. Store frozen individual biscuits in sealable freezer bag until ready to bake. It's nice to keep cream biscuits in the freezer for hot biscuits any time. Delicious and easy!
